FJ Company Sport

FJ Company specialize in performing full, frame-off restorations of the classic Japanese Toyota FJ series. Built for the serious Toyota FJ enthusiast, The Sport is the most modern Land Cruiser in FJ Company´s lineup, an authentic FJ40 or FJ43, completely re-engineered with a Toyota 1FZ engine (210hp), electronic fuel injection, 5-speed manual, upgraded performance steering system, Air conditioning & heating, and more. You can also add luxury options you’d expect in a modern SUV, like rear back-up camera, heated seats, premium sound system, bluetooth, and more.
